I haven't used it much, so I can't vouch for it's
reliability/performance/whatever (and apparently neither does Oracle),
but I have an Oracle 9i Personal database running on a Windows ME
machine.
There's something's wrong with the installation routine. To get around it:
After the initial installation, run Universal installer again and install the Corba stuff, then re-run the database config assistant again.
